Output d95f6f005e6a8703c9fbe01975b5fc2e3128fdbd7f30c72fcf3bc52a561130b2:4

value
674321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b8162601f7513b0b29d8f582231beb551c9e0fc OP_EQUAL
address
3PAFiQDyG3dud6fCjoKYeHwkUd7Zmbcb9P
transaction
d95f6f005e6a8703c9fbe01975b5fc2e3128fdbd7f30c72fcf3bc52a561130b2
confirmations
154981
spent
true